Psychedelics Encyclopedia Peter Stafford p.70 "For those concerned about immediate medical hazards in ingesting LSD...Abram Hoffer has estimated, on the basis of animal studies, that the half-lethal human dose--meaning half would die--would be about 14,000 [ug]. But one person who took 40,000 ug survived. In the only case of death reportedly caused by overdose (Journal of the Kentucky Medical Association), the quantity of LSD in the blood indicated that 320,000 ug had been injected intravenously." http://www.erowid.org/chemicals/lsd/lsd_dose.shtml I have heard stories about people eating massive amounts of acid before it was illegal, and I think the lethal dose is wrong on erowid.org and whereever else they say.
